Not the sort of thing you'd expect in/around Udon.....but a mere 26 or so km SW of Udon there's going to be a Lifestock Show and Rodeo 10-12 January at the P.C. Ranch.
There's a full schedule of events (in Thai) at the link below. After you pass the Nongwahsaw four-way intersection, continue toward Nongbualamphu about 8 or so KM. You'll see signs for PC Ranch on the right.

พี.ซี. แรนซ์ 237 หมู่ 1 บ้านโนนทัน ตำบลโนนทัน อ.เมือง จ.หนองบัวลำภู 39000 โทร. 01-9744949
PC Ranch 237 M. 1, Ban Noon Tan, Nong Bua Lam Phu (it's on the border line of Nongbualamphu and Udon).

Easy to get to. Plenty of parking. There is a big sign on the highway indicating the turn, just follow the flags and signs, it's about 3.5 kms from the highway. The turnoff is about 5 kms past the Nong Wau Sau traffic light. There are two main areas, one with the coffee shop and the main entertainment area, the other with the petting zoo. I believe it's open all the time, we are going back next weekend for riding lessons for the children.

My wife and I are easily impressed.....so be forewarned.
Lacking other things to do today.....nice breezy cool day....we drove out to PC Ranch for our first ever visit. If you want to tour the animals, entrance costs 100Baht per person. If you just want to use their restaurant, no charge.
We ate lunch.....both my wife and I a burger....300 Baht each....not cheap, but the service was good, the burger was delicious, and there were plenty of photo opportunities in the room while we waited for our meal.
Then we took a tour of the ranch in a chauffeured large golf cart......Brahma bulls, long horns, sheep, goats, a wide variety of horses, donkeys, deer, muscats, fox, a prairie dog......all the animals were kept in very clean and well-maintained facilities. No small cages/pens. There were enough photo opportunities to go through several rolls of film and flash bulbs.........and if you wanted to pay extra, you could ride a variety of their vehicles around the premises. There's also a Harry Potter setup that kids might enjoy.
According to our driver, the owner (.......perhaps of Ban Chiang Hotel family) has plans for a major water park as well as other attractions.
My wife and I would have no problem returning for another tour....definitely cool season.......just as an escape close to home.
And if you're interested, the jungle market is a mere few km up the road.
